The effectiveness of thyroid medication, such as levothyroxine, relies heavily on consistent and proper absorption. Unfortunately, many common vitamins and minerals can form complexes with the medication in the digestive tract, preventing your body from absorbing the full dose. This can lead to suboptimal hormone levels, causing continued symptoms of hypothyroidism. To ensure your treatment is as effective as possible, it is vital to know which supplements to avoid or, more accurately, to carefully time.
The Primary Culprits: Calcium and Iron
Calcium and iron are the most well-known offenders when it comes to interfering with the absorption of thyroid hormone replacement drugs. This interaction is a common issue for many people, especially since both calcium and iron are often included in multivitamins and prescribed for separate health issues like osteoporosis and anemia.
How Calcium and Iron Interfere
Both calcium and iron can bind to levothyroxine in the gastrointestinal tract. This process, known as chelation, creates a new compound that the body cannot easily absorb, reducing the amount of medication that reaches the bloodstream. Studies have shown a significant decrease in thyroid hormone levels when these minerals are taken concurrently with the medication. This is why it is recommended to separate your thyroid medication from these supplements by at least four hours.
Sources of Hidden Calcium and Iron
The interaction isn't limited to supplements alone. You must also be mindful of sources from fortified foods and certain beverages.
- Calcium-fortified products: This includes certain brands of orange juice, non-dairy milks, and cereals. Many dairy products are also rich in calcium.
- Multivitamins: Most daily multivitamins contain both iron and calcium to provide comprehensive nutritional support. Patients often do not realize this can be a problem.
- Antacids: Many antacids contain calcium carbonate, which will also interfere with absorption.
- Iron-fortified cereals and cereals: Like calcium, many grains and cereals are fortified with iron.
- Dietary Sources: Eating iron-rich foods like meat or beans too close to your medication can also be problematic.
The Vitamin That Skews Your Lab Tests: Biotin
Biotin, also known as Vitamin B7, does not physically interfere with the absorption of thyroid medication. However, high doses of biotin can significantly impact the accuracy of thyroid function tests, leading to misleading results.
How Biotin Causes False Readings
Many thyroid tests, particularly those for TSH, T3, and T4, use immunoassay technology. Biotin is a common ingredient in many supplements for hair, skin, and nail health, and it is used in the immunoassay process. High levels of biotin in the blood can interfere with the test results, causing falsely low TSH readings or falsely high T4 and T3 readings. This could lead to a doctor mistakenly believing your thyroid hormone levels are in the normal range, when in reality they are not.
Proper Biotin Management
To ensure accurate test results, most healthcare professionals recommend discontinuing high-dose biotin supplements for at least 48 to 72 hours before a scheduled thyroid function test. It is always best to inform your doctor about any supplements you are taking before lab work is performed.
The Complex Case of Iodine
Iodine is a mineral essential for the production of thyroid hormones. The thyroid gland requires iodine to function properly, but the relationship is delicate. Excessive iodine can be as detrimental as a deficiency, especially for people with certain thyroid conditions.
Risks of Excess Iodine
- Triggering or worsening autoimmune thyroid disease: In individuals with autoimmune conditions like Hashimoto's, high levels of iodine from supplements can exacerbate inflammation and trigger an autoimmune response against the thyroid gland.
- Suppression of thyroid function: In some cases, too much iodine can suppress thyroid hormone production, leading to worsening hypothyroidism.
- Hyperthyroidism: Conversely, an oversupply of iodine can also lead to an overactive thyroid, causing symptoms like palpitations and anxiety.
Due to these risks, it is best to avoid iodine supplements, such as kelp or bladderwrack, unless a specific deficiency has been diagnosed and your doctor has recommended it. For most people in the U.S., sufficient iodine is obtained through iodized salt and other common food sources.
Understanding Multivitamin Complications
As mentioned, multivitamins are problematic because they often contain a combination of interfering minerals like calcium and iron. Taking a multivitamin with your morning thyroid medication can severely reduce its effectiveness. The solution is simple but requires consistency: separate the timing.
Strategies for Multivitamin Use
Instead of taking all supplements at once, establish a consistent routine. A common recommendation is to take your thyroid medication first thing in the morning on an empty stomach, then take your multivitamin later in the day, preferably with lunch or dinner, at least four hours after your thyroid dose.
Other Substances That Can Affect Absorption
Beyond the major vitamin and mineral interactions, several other dietary and supplemental factors can impact thyroid medication absorption. Being aware of these can further optimize your treatment.
- Soy Products: Soy has been shown to interfere with levothyroxine absorption. Consistent daily intake is key; if you consume soy regularly, your doctor may need to adjust your medication dose.
- High-Fiber Foods: Large amounts of dietary fiber can also reduce medication absorption. This includes fiber supplements and high-fiber cereals. Take thyroid medication away from high-fiber meals.
- Coffee: The acidity and compounds in coffee can negatively impact absorption. It is best to wait at least 30 to 60 minutes after taking your medication before drinking coffee.
- Grapefruit Juice: Like with many medications, grapefruit juice can interfere with the breakdown of levothyroxine. It's best to avoid it around the time of your dose.
- Other Minerals: Some antacids contain aluminum or magnesium, which can also interfere with absorption. Check the labels of all your supplements and over-the-counter medications.
Guide to Common Supplements and Thyroid Medication
Supplement | Type of Interaction | Recommended Action |
---|---|---|
Calcium | Reduces absorption by binding to the medication. | Take at least 4 hours apart. |
Iron | Reduces absorption by binding to the medication. | Take at least 4 hours apart. |
Biotin (High Dose) | Interferes with laboratory test results, causing false readings. | Stop taking 2-3 days before any thyroid function tests. |
Iodine | Can trigger or worsen autoimmune conditions; excessive amounts can suppress or overstimulate the thyroid. | Avoid unless specifically prescribed and monitored by a doctor. |
Multivitamins | Often contain calcium and iron, which block absorption. | Take at least 4 hours apart from thyroid medication. |
Soy | May reduce absorption. | Take medication away from soy-based meals; inform doctor if consuming regularly. |
High-Fiber Foods | Can reduce medication absorption. | Take thyroid medication on an empty stomach, away from high-fiber meals. |
The Importance of Consistent Timing
For most thyroid hormone replacement medications, a consistent daily routine is the single most important factor for success. By taking your medication at the same time each day on an empty stomach and waiting several hours before consuming any potentially interfering vitamins, minerals, or foods, you ensure a steady and reliable level of thyroid hormone in your system. This stability is key to effectively managing your condition and avoiding the fluctuation of symptoms.
What To Do
- Take medication first: The best practice is to take your thyroid medication with a full glass of water, ideally 30-60 minutes before breakfast.
- Delay other supplements: Wait at least four hours before taking any supplements containing calcium, iron, or zinc. This includes multivitamins and antacids.
- Inform your doctor: Always discuss your full list of supplements and medications with your healthcare provider. They can help you create a personalized schedule that works for you and ensures your treatment remains effective.
